01Shop fundamentals

A practical starting point for safe, accurate work in the machine shop.

  • Mechanical aptitude
  • Basic shop safety
  • Basic blueprint reading
  • Basic applied shop mathematics
  • Precision machining technology
02Print reading, mathematics & measurement

Develop the technical fluency needed to interpret requirements and work with precision.

  • Intermediate blueprint reading
  • Shop measurements and applied mathematics
  • Intermediate and advanced applied mathematics
  • Geometric dimensioning and tolerancing (GD&T)
03CNC & manufacturing technology

Extend machining knowledge into advanced processes and material behavior.

  • CNC milling
  • Advanced manufacturing procedures: turning
  • Manufacturing technology
  • Metallurgy
04CAD, tooling & specialized applications

Explore the tools and techniques behind specialized manufacturing work.

  • Autodesk Fusion 360
  • SolidWorks
  • Diemaking and advanced diemaking
  • Moldmaking
  • Jigs and fixtures
05Quality & inspection

Learn to interpret specifications, assess quality, and support consistent production.

  • Quality control
  • Statistical process control (SPC)
  • Inspection
  • GD&T applications
